What This Test Measures and Detects
This specialized genetic test specifically targets the TSHB (Thyroid Stimulating Hormone Beta subunit) gene located on chromosome 1p13. The test identifies:
- Point mutations, deletions, and insertions in the TSHB gene
- Genetic variants affecting TSH beta-subunit production
- Mutations leading to impaired thyroid-stimulating hormone synthesis
- Specific genetic markers associated with congenital nongoitrous hypothyroidism type 4
- Inheritance patterns through comprehensive genetic analysis
Clinical Indications: Who Should Consider This Test
This genetic screening is recommended for individuals presenting with:
- Newborns with abnormal thyroid screening results
- Infants showing signs of congenital hypothyroidism including prolonged jaundice, feeding difficulties, and constipation
- Children with developmental delays potentially linked to thyroid dysfunction
- Families with a history of congenital hypothyroidism or thyroid disorders
- Siblings of affected individuals for carrier screening
- Cases where standard thyroid function tests indicate TSH deficiency

Understanding Your Test Results
Our comprehensive genetic report provides clear interpretation of your results:
- Positive Result: Indicates presence of TSHB gene mutation, confirming congenital hypothyroidism diagnosis
- Negative Result: Suggests absence of tested mutations, though other genetic causes may exist
- Variant of Uncertain Significance: Requires additional clinical correlation and family studies
- Carrier Status: Identifies individuals who may pass the condition to offspring
